![]() |
|
Forum
|
|
|
#1 (permalink) |
|
XLDnaute Nouveau
Date d'inscription: juillet 2006
Messages: 32
|
Bonjour à toutes et tous,
En VBA j'ai un code erreur "Erreur de compilation dans le module caché 37" qui pointe vers la fonction "Mid" qui permet d'extraire les x caractères d'une chaîne de caractères nommée "S" Var1 = Mid(S, 1, 5 - 0) Si en début de code je déclare Dim Mid celà n'a pas de sens et bien sur ne fonctionne pas. Comment je peux faire pour déclarer cette fonction pour ne plus avoir de message d'erreur ? D'avance merci pour vos réponses. Cordialement Pierre |
|
|
|
|
|
#2 (permalink) |
|
XLDnaute Impliqué
Date d'inscription: avril 2007
Localisation: 59186 ANOR
Version Excel : Excel 2003 (PC)
Messages: 755
|
bonjour à toi,
il serait peut-être préférable de commencer par déclarer tes variables en alphanumérique c'est beaucoup plus compréhensible et moins d'erreur ! S$="abcdefgh..." puis Var1$= Left(S$, 5) Var1 = Mid(S, 1, 5 - 0) ? et pour faire ça, autant prendre Left() à plus. Roland |
|
|
|
| ANNONCES | |
![]() |
| Liens sociaux |
| Outils de la discussion | |
|
|
Discussions similaires
|
||||
| Discussion | Auteur | Forum | Réponses | Dernier message |
| declaration de type | wilfried_42 | Forum Excel | 6 | 19/11/2006 02h02 |
| déclaration variable | patbarth | Forum Excel | 10 | 28/05/2006 18h34 |
| Déclaration de variables | photoechange | Forum Excel | 8 | 05/04/2006 18h36 |
| déclaration des variables | seb71 | Forum Excel | 1 | 06/03/2005 22h57 |
| Déclaration de Constantes | ChTi'160 | Forum Excel Downloads - Archives | 2 | 13/02/2005 23h13 |